In 2020-2021, 18,997 people earned their degree in general social sciences, making the major the 54th most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, general social sciences gra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$32,991 and had an average of $24,438 in loans still to pay off.
Across Idaho, there were 39 general social s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$27,337 and $25,544 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 33 general social s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$37,020 and $24,050 respectively.
This year’s “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on Social Sciences Major in Idaho” ranking looked at 2 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in general social sciences. This a ranking of the schools where the largest percentage of students has enrolled in general social sciences.
